Слово англійською: install
Дієслово
Переклад install українською: устано́влювати, встано́влювати, установи́ти (при́стрій і т. д.), інсталюва́ти, встанови́ти (при́стрій і т. д.), змонтува́ти, монтува́ти, прово́дити що куди́ (опа́лення)

install
verb /ɪnˈstɔːl/
(also British English, less frequent instal)
- install something to fix equipment or furniture into position so that it can be used
- They're planning to install a new drainage system.
- Make sure the equipment is properly installed.
- A hidden camera had been installed in the room.
- install something to put a new program onto a computer
- to install software/an app
- Do not download and install programs from websites that you are unfamiliar with.
- install something on something Be selective about the apps you install on your device.

- install somebody (as something) to put somebody in a new position of authority, often with an official ceremony
- He was installed as President last May.
- She was recently installed as president of the National Medical Association.
- install somebody/yourself (+ adv./prep.) to make somebody/yourself comfortable in a particular place or position
- We installed ourselves in the front row.
- She saw her guests safely installed in their rooms and then went downstairs.
Word Originlate Middle English (in sense (3)): from medieval Latin installare, from in- ‘into’ + stallum ‘place, stall’. Sense (1) dates from the mid 19th cent.
